33rd UAPB AM&N National Alumni Association Summer Conference
by Shannon Hendrix
2021-2023 Summer Conference Chair, National UAPB/AM&N Alumni Parliamentarian
The conference was held August 3-5, 2023, in Pine Bluff, Arkansas, with a majority of the meetings and activities held on the campus of the University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ff. This was our first in-person Summer Conference since the 2020 pandemic. Having the two prior virtual conferences, along with our newly designed website, newsletters, Alumni Center Capital Campaign, and various town hall meetings, allowed us to create an agenda with all alumni in mind.
National Alumni Association President Tanesha Thompson and the National Board of Directors, hosted this year’s conference. However, there was great support from the National Alumni Office and three local alumni chapters who served as the conference’s Planning Committee bringing a wealth of knowledge and a talented network to carry out the business of the Association. The conference included a National Board Meeting, Welcome Reception, Updates from both the Association and the University, Campus Bus Tour, and Banquet which included a silent auction, cocktail hour, and dancing.
Our banquet speaker was Kristopher G. Stepps, MD, who is also a 2007 alumnus, Legacy Golden Lion, published author, philanthropist, and Pine Bluff native. Dr. Stepps spoke from our conference theme about the mnemonic R.O.A.R. which stood for:
- Remember your Golden Predecessors,
- Open as many doors as possible,
- Be Asset-driven, and
- Recruit future stakeholders.
All of these attributes were passionately discussed during the many activities of the conference.
The 2023 Summer Conference had over 105 registered participants, over 30 additional banquet tickets sold, and raised over $1,500 for the Dire Needs Scholarship with the silent auction alone. President Thompson encouraged all alumni and supporters of the Association and the University to be solution-focused, and with that mindset, we were able to have a successful 33rd National Alumni Summer Conference.
